I'm looking for some advice on what to do with our Mira Sport shower. Its about 6/7 years old and is on the blink. After looking at other threads about why this might be, I'd hazard a guess at the flow regulator or thermostat.

The question is of course, would I be better off buying a new shower, and if so, what type should I go for? Reason I ask that is because last year we had a new combi-system put in, and what I can't quite get my head round the pros/cons of different types of showers running off a combi-system.

The sport is electric the disadvantage for me of electric is they always lack the power of one run from a combi boiler, the advantage is when your boiler goes on the blink you still have hot water.
I personally prefer showers run from the combi boiler I have got a cheap mira coda it was no more than £130 it lets plenty of water through and its thermostatic which means when someone flushes the toilet or washes the pots you dont end up with 3rd degree burns it just limits the hot to balance out the temperature.
